GraphQL Schema Designer Skill

Overview

This skill specializes in designing, optimizing, and maintaining GraphQL schemas with support for schema stitching, federation, and advanced patterns. It ensures type-safe, performant, and well-documented GraphQL APIs.

Capabilities

  • Design type-safe GraphQL schemas following best practices
  • Implement schema stitching and Apollo Federation
  • Optimize query complexity and configure depth limits
  • Generate comprehensive schema documentation
  • Design efficient resolver patterns
  • Implement pagination (Relay connections, offset-based)
  • Configure subscriptions and real-time features
  • Validate schema against design guidelines

Best Practices

  1. Use meaningful type and field names
  2. Implement proper nullability patterns
  3. Design for pagination from the start
  4. Document all types and fields
  5. Use interfaces for polymorphism
  6. Implement proper error handling with union types
